The .NET Micro Framework for Linux is a small, free and open-source platform by Microsoft that allows writing .NET applications for resource-constrained devices running Linux. It includes a small version of the .NET runtime and libraries.

Flow Powered by Amazon is a low-code application development platform that allows users to create workflows and custom applications without programming knowledge. It offers a simple visual interface with prebuilt templates, connectors for popular services, and drag and drop functionality for building process flows.
